• SOURCE DETAIL: Similarly to Argodiode battery isolators, Argofet isolators allow simultaneous charging of two or more batteries from one alternator (or a single output battery charger), without connecting the batteries together.
• ELECTRICAL RATING: In contrast with Argodiode battery isolators, Argofet isolators have virtually no voltage loss.
• ELECTRICAL RATING: Voltage drop is less than 0,02 Volt at low current and averages 0,1 Volt at higher currents.
